Magician Debuts on Centre Court

With the luck of the draw, the French “magician” Fabrice Santoro is playing Scotsman and the hope of British tennis, Andy Murray, in the first round at Wimbledon. Santoro will play on Centre Court... in front of most likely a very pro-Murray crowd. Ironically, the 35 year old Santoro had hoped to play a singles match on Centre Court during his final Wimbledon in 2008 because he had never played singles there during his long career. Santoro, who reached the doubles finals at Wimbledon, plays a unique style of tennis and his game and flair will be missed when he takes his final bow at Wimbledon.
